Transaction 63aa55da901ea576da6b472eb4a79cc8d338a177d18d6f2a2861900f4e62ed68

1 Input
2 Outputs
  • 63aa55da901ea576da6b472eb4a79cc8d338a177d18d6f2a2861900f4e62ed68:0
  • value  2063507
    address  3KDWeBxdzjdGKuzPdgDbQhgb4hoJhXYTY3
  • 63aa55da901ea576da6b472eb4a79cc8d338a177d18d6f2a2861900f4e62ed68:1
  • value  106214
    address  bc1q5jaesasxksjp9p8z90wv66jxwx92tmqtpkfanv